Ive always wanted a Dewalt drill and now that I have one Im glad I bought it. Ive owned MANY cordless drills from Craftsman to Black and Decker and most in between. The secret is in the battery. This drill comes with two. Ive fallen for the cheapo Harbor Freight $20 drills but they last about a year. The drill doesn die but the battery does. It simply doesn hold a charge. I can shelf my Dewalt for 6 months and it holds a charge like new. Not that youd want to but the battery quality makes ANY cordless tool. Well balanced and just feels right. To me well worth the $$. : 2012-05-12 15:40:58

No more lithium-ion for me |
I purchased this item for only $99 at HD. This unit includes 2 Ni-cad batteries. Why get these instead of the newer Lithium-ion? Research on the web shows that Lithium-ion batteries have a shelf life between 2-3 years. So, unlike Ni-cads, EVEN IF YOU DONT USE THEM, they will degrade and need replacing in a couple of years. How long have they been sitting on the shelf before you buy them is anyones guess but that is part of the batterys shelf life. Then when you do go buy new ones they cost as much as the kit did to begin with.
Perhaps if you are a professional that uses the drill all day, day after day you will be ready for a new kit every couple of years. But for the average Joe who might not use the drill for 3-4 months, you are losing battery life regardless.
Do your wallet a favor and stick with Ni-cads until the technology improves. This is an excellent drill with plenty of power. Also, Ni-cads continue to work in cold weather unlike Lithium-ions that won .
